> This is my respin of Alex's v2 series [1].
> 
> The first 8 patches are preparation for the patch 9, the subject matter
> of this series, which enables lockless translation block lookup. The
> main change here is that Paolo's suggestion is implemented: TBs are
> marked with invalid CPU state early during invalidation. This allows to
> make lockless lookup safe from races on 'tb_jmp_cache' and direct block
> chaining.

Thanks for looking at the suggestion again and especially for perfecting it!

> The patch 10 is a simple solution to avoid unnecessary bouncing on
> 'tb_lock' between tb_gen_code() and tb_add_jump(). A local variable is
> used to keep track of whether 'tb_lock' has already been taken.
> 
> The last patch is my attempt to restructure tb_find_{fast,slow}() into a
> single function tb_find(). I think it will be easier to follow the
> locking scheme this way. However, I am afraid this last patch can be
> controversial, so it can be simply dropped.

Actually I agree entirely with it.

If anything, for historical reasons one might rename tb_find_physical to
tb_find_slow and leave the tb_find_fast name, but I think the patch is
good as is.
